What Is Emotional Abuse?

Emotional abuse involves abusive behavior that causes psychological or mental trauma. Emotional abuse does not require physical harm. Emotional abuse can involve threats of harm, bullying, isolation, exposure to violence, and neglect. Emotional abuse is common in cases of child abuse and domestic violence.

What Are Some Examples of Emotional Abuse Situations Where I Might Need a Family Law Attorney?

Victims of emotional abuse may not know their abuser is committing a crime. Some emotional abuse, such as threats of violence, is criminal, even if it does not cause physical harm. A family law attorney can explain your legal options to get free from abuse and find the resources to move on after an abusive relationship. A family lawyer will act in your best interests to get the help you need.

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Family Law Attorney To Help With Emotional Abuse?

Without an advocate on your side, you may continue to suffer emotional and psychological abuse. It is difficult to break the cycle of abuse. Many abusers manipulate their victims to rely on them for physical and financial support. An attorney can step in to help you break the cycle and get help for you and your children.
